A favorite landmark we always look for as we head for Interstate Highway 65 is the castle in Triune, Tennessee. Some twenty years or more ago a fellow began to build his dream home, his very own castle. To help pay his way to the 1400s, he began to hold Renaissance Fairs on his property. It has become an annual event. We always enjoy the sight of this splendorous place.
